Third baseman Conrad Gregor belted a three-run home run in the bottom of the eighth inning to give New Jersey an 11-10 lead and they would go on to win by that same score over Ottawa.
The Jackals had nine hits on the night with four batters having multi-hit games. Gregor went 2-for-5 with two runs scored and three RBIs while 2B Andrew Dundon had a two-hit game, including a home run, along with five RBIs. Left fielder Alfredo Marte also helped the New Jersey offense by plating three runs and walking twice in a 2-for-3 night.
Jackals pitcher Christian Tessitore tossed a scoreless inning of relief and grabbed the victory in his first outing with the team. Tessitore gave up a hit in the three batters faced.
Center fielder Trey Martin had a 3-for-4 outing with two doubles, four runs scored and three RBIs in the loss for the Champions.
